当前位置: 首页 > news >正文

Akagi雀魂智能助手:从安装到实战的全方位技术指南

Akagi雀魂智能助手:从安装到实战的全方位技术指南

【免费下载链接】AkagiA helper client for Majsoul项目地址: https://gitcode.com/gh_mirrors/ak/Akagi

1. 价值定位:重新定义麻将AI辅助体验

Akagi雀魂助手作为一款开源智能客户端,通过深度整合AI决策引擎与实时游戏分析技术,为麻将爱好者提供从牌局数据采集到策略推荐的全流程辅助。该工具采用轻量化架构设计,支持多平台部署,既能满足新手玩家的基础辅助需求,也能为进阶玩家提供专业级数据分析支持。核心优势在于其毫秒级响应的模型推理(AI对牌局数据的实时计算过程)能力与高度可定制的策略配置系统,让每位用户都能构建符合个人风格的辅助方案。

2. 3步场景化部署:零基础环境搭建指南

2.1 环境准备与代码获取

🔧第一步:克隆项目仓库

git clone https://gitcode.com/gh_mirrors/ak/Akagi cd Akagi

✅ 验证方法:执行后应看到项目目录结构,包含mjai/、mahjong_soul_api/等核心文件夹

2.2 系统专属安装流程

Windows平台部署

🔧管理员PowerShell执行安装脚本

scripts\install_akagi.ps1

⚠️ 注意事项:若出现权限提示请选择"是",安装过程需保持网络畅通

macOS平台部署

🔧终端执行自动化安装

bash scripts/install_akagi.command

✅ 验证方法:脚本执行完成后应显示"环境配置成功"提示

2.3 核心资源配置

🔧模型文件部署

  1. 将下载的AI模型文件放置于mjai/bot/目录
  2. 重命名模型文件为"mortal.pth"
  3. 检查文件权限确保可读

💡 小提示:模型文件建议通过官方渠道获取,第三方模型可能存在兼容性问题

3. 功能矩阵:五大核心模块深度解析

3.1 智能决策引擎

在竞技场景中,系统会自动捕获当前手牌、剩余牌池与对手行为数据,通过内置算法生成最优操作建议。例如在东一局南家听牌阶段,引擎会综合考虑场况风险与胡牌概率,在config.json中配置的"risk_level"参数将直接影响推荐策略的保守程度。

3.2 实时数据采集系统

当游戏进行时,工具通过协议解析技术记录每局的打牌顺序、杠碰吃操作与分数变化,数据以JSON格式实时存储。开发人员可通过修改mahjong_soul_api/ms/rpc.py中的回调函数,自定义数据采集的粒度与存储方式。

3.3 个性化配置中心

通过编辑项目根目录的config.json文件,用户可灵活调整:

  • 雀魂账号绑定参数
  • AI分析频率(建议设为200ms/次)
  • 界面显示风格与提示方式

3.4 多模式交互界面

提供三种操作模式满足不同场景需求:

  • 极简模式:仅显示核心决策建议
  • 专业模式:展示完整概率分析图表
  • 教学模式:附带策略解释与牌理说明

3.5 协议解析与适配模块

自动适配雀魂游戏的协议更新,通过liqi_proto/liqi.proto定义的接口规范,确保在游戏版本更新后仍能保持功能完整性。

4. 实战锦囊:安全高效使用指南

4.1 风险预防机制

⚠️账号安全保护

  • 启用settings.json中的"anti_detection"功能
  • 设置随机操作延迟(推荐300-800ms)
  • 避免连续使用超过2小时

4.2 异常处理方案

当出现"模型加载失败"提示时:

  1. 检查mjai/bot/mortal.pth文件完整性
  2. 执行依赖修复命令:
pip install -r requirement.txt --upgrade
  1. 验证模型文件MD5值是否匹配官方提供的校验码

4.3 合规使用指南

  • 仅用于个人学习研究,不用于商业用途
  • 遵守游戏平台用户协议,合理使用辅助功能
  • 定期更新工具版本以获取安全补丁

💡 小提示:可通过修改mhm/config.py中的"log_level"参数开启详细日志,便于问题排查

5. 问题速解:常见故障排除手册

5.1 启动时证书错误

现象:程序启动后提示"SSL certificate verify failed"
排查路径

  1. 检查系统证书库是否包含项目证书
  2. 确认安装脚本已正确执行证书导入步骤
    解决命令
# 重新安装证书 python -m certifi

5.2 AI分析无响应

现象:游戏中未显示决策建议
排查路径

  1. 检查mjai/bot/目录是否存在模型文件
  2. 查看终端输出是否有"model loaded"提示
    解决命令
# 检查模型文件权限 ls -l mjai/bot/mortal.pth

5.3 网络连接失败

现象:提示"无法连接到游戏服务器"
排查路径

  1. 检查config.json中的代理设置
  2. 测试网络连通性
    解决命令
# 测试网络连通性 curl -I https://majsoul.union-game.com

通过本指南的系统部署与功能解析,您已掌握Akagi雀魂助手的核心使用方法。记住,工具的价值在于辅助提升游戏理解能力,合理使用才能真正享受麻将竞技的乐趣与成长。定期关注项目更新,获取更多高级功能与优化体验。

【免费下载链接】AkagiA helper client for Majsoul项目地址: https://gitcode.com/gh_mirrors/ak/Akagi

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

http://www.jsqmd.com/news/433886/

相关文章:

  • AI版权侵权难以“定罪”?Copyright Detective:首个集成多范式检测的交互式版权取证系统
  • 如何用轻量化工具解决macOS录屏三大痛点:QuickRecorder全解析
  • 开源视频修复工具Untrunc全攻略:从问题诊断到高效恢复MP4文件
  • 【2025最新】基于SpringBoot+Vue的考研互助交流平台管理系统源码+MyBatis+MySQL
  • 飞书开放平台Python SDK全栈开发指南:从接口调用到企业级集成
  • Cosmos-Reason1-7B数据库课程设计助手:从ER图到SQL语句的智能生成
  • 雀魂智能分析助手:从新手到高手的实战提升新手指南
  • 3个技巧让你成为Linux文件搜索高手:FSearch使用指南
  • ChatGPT登录效率优化实战:从认证流程到自动化脚本实现
  • 3个颠覆式方法:picture-in-picture-chrome-extension让视频观看与多任务处理无缝融合
  • 解锁PDF自动化处理:3大核心模块打造企业级文档工作流
  • 3大核心优势,让Steam成就管理不再复杂:给玩家和开发者的开源工具
  • 重启 openJiuwen:从官网踩坑到本地部署成功的避坑指南
  • MogFace-large与YOLOv11对比评测:人脸检测领域的性能对决
  • 从零搭建基于Ollama的AI聊天机器人:架构设计与生产环境避坑指南
  • G-Helper轻量控制工具:华硕笔记本性能释放与系统优化新体验
  • G-Helper硬件控制指南:从能效管理到场景化优化的深度探索
  • CYBER-VISION零号协议一键部署教程:Python环境快速配置指南
  • Qwen3-ASR-0.6B量化部署:显存优化实战指南
  • 再见了SpringBoot,AI开发已成气候!
  • 3步高效迁移:零风险SVN到Git版本控制系统转换实战指南
  • 重构macOS录屏体验:QuickRecorder轻量化工具的革新方案
  • 3步恢复色彩配置:让ROG游戏本重获专业显示效果
  • 如何用DoKit实现移动应用全生命周期开发效率倍增
  • 告别数据标注!Git-RSCLIP在应急监测与快速普查中的实战应用
  • 图网络实战指南:从Cora到Yelp,六大经典数据集深度解析与应用场景
  • Youtu-Parsing批量处理教程:100+页扫描文档自动化解析与结果合并策略
  • Qwen3-VL-2B省钱部署:低成本实现图文理解功能
  • Jimeng AI Studio开发者手册:st.session_state缓存机制避免重复加载卡顿
  • 3步打造稳定网络:MacBook连接优化实战指南